1. Health Inspectors Cite Ongoing Cockroach Infestation in Downingtown Restaurant (mychesco.com) — Health officials recently cited Nalan Indian Cuisine on E. Lancaster Ave. in Downingtown for an ongoing German cockroach infestation affecting food prep, storage, and cooking areas. Inspectors ordered deep cleaning, sealing gaps, and professional pest control, and reminded residents they can report suspected food safety issues directly to the Chester County Health Department.

Downingtown vigilante who ‘hunted' pedophiles sentenced to prison for beating elderly man with hammer (inquirer.com) — A Downingtown resident who portrayed himself online as a vigilante targeting suspected pedophiles has been sentenced to state prison for a violent 2024 assault on an elderly man in West Chester. Prosecutors detailed severe, recorded abuse and lasting injuries before the victim’s death, while the defense cited the defendant’s past trauma and mental health issues.

Downingtown STEM Academy Alum Helped Make NASA's Artemis II Mission Possible (vista.today) — A Downingtown STEM Academy graduate just helped make NASA’s Artemis II moon mission a success, and the Downingtown Area School District is celebrating his achievement. Cameron O’Rourke, now a NASA engineer, credits his STEM Academy education with shaping the skills and confidence that carried him from Chester County classrooms to the Kennedy Space Center launch team.

Lowe's Employees Had to Use a Forklift to Rescue 7 Newborn Kittens From a High Shelf (star-telegram.com) — Seven newborn kittens were discovered high on a shelf at the Lowe’s on Cornerstone Boulevard in Downingtown, prompting employees to use a forklift so rescuers could safely reach them. Chester County’s Lucky Dawg Animal Rescue is now bottle-feeding the kittens, charmingly named after hardware-store themes, and expects they’ll be ready for local adoption in about six to seven weeks.

Quick start helps Shanahan end three-game losing streak by beating Coatesville (centredaily.com) — Bishop Shanahan’s girls lacrosse team bounced back in Downingtown with a dominant 18-7 win over Coatesville at Jack Mancini Stadium, snapping a rare three-game skid that included a loss to Downingtown West. Eleven Eagles scored, with strong defense and a fast 10-0 start setting the tone for a much-needed Ches-Mont League confidence boost.
